Catholic League Hosts Annual Prep Bowl at Ford Field Oct. 24
Issued: October 21, 2009
The Catholic League Football Championships will be played at Ford Field on Saturday, October 24. Working reporters and camera crews will be admitted through Gate G with league issued credentials. HIGHLIGHTS:
- For the 28th consecutive year the Prep Bowl will present a medallion to the Scholastic All Catholic team comprised on the top student in each class in the 25 Catholic League High Schools.
- The 37th annual Prep Bowl will honor the Soup Bowl and Goodfellow Champions from 50 years ago, the St. Ambrose Cavaliers. Members of that team along with Coach Tom Boisture and Rick Gosselin (author of the book Goodfellows) will be honored before the 4:00 AB Championship game.
- Performing the coin toss prior to each game will be Thor, a member of the World Champion University of Detroit Mercy Robotics team.
- The Catholic League's first football Championship game was played on Thanksgiving Day in 1926 at Southwestern Field between Holy Redeemer and St. Leo.
The Prep Bowl is sponsored by the Knights of Columbus, Adidas, Top Cat Sales, Ford Field, and Buddy's Pizza.
